Price cut on Derecktor motor yacht Silent Wings II at Bradford Marine

1 May 2014 • Written by Malcolm MacLean

Bradford Marine Yacht Sales sends news of a $100,000 price drop on Tucker Fallon's listing for sale, the 31.7m motor yacht Silent Wings II.

Built by US superyacht yard Derecktor to a design by Holland's Diana Yacht Design, Silent Wings II was delivered in 1990. A Dee Robinson interior employs fine English walnut joinery throughout, and the saloon has large opening windows plus a formal dining area for eight guests and ample storage for crockery, linen and crystal.

Six guests are accommodated in three staterooms. The main deck VIP suite could easily be used as a master stateroom with plentiful storage, a king size bed and its own separate door to the side deck. Access to the lower staterooms is via a spiral staircase to a full beam master suite with a king size bed and a large couch. There is also a twin cabin and all staterooms have en suite bathroom facilities.

A planing hull and twin 1,500hp MTU engines linked to water jets power Silent Wings II to a maximum speed of 12 knots and a cruising speed of nine knots.

Located in Fort Lauderdale, Florida, Silent Wings II is now asking $1,145,000.
